Fiscal Note Summary


Effect this measure will have on costs and revenues of state government.


The stated purpose of this bill is to eliminate sales tax on utility payments for residential users. As drafted, the bill appears to remove residential commodity consumption from the tax base through a definitional cross-reference to W.Va. Code 11-15A-1 and also creates ambiguity regarding pass-through billing and collection for remaining non-residential customers. Accordingly, a substantial portion of current municipal public utilities tax collections (budgeted at $29 million across all municipalities) could be reduced or disrupted and municipalities may face heightened revenue uncertainty pending clarification, ordinance revisions, or administrative/judicial resolution.
